Chin from the popular South Korean group BTS will be a torchbearer at the 2024 Olympics. The musician is reported to be traveling to France in the near future, Yonhap news agency writes about this.
The interpreter is the first member of the group to return from the army after compulsory service. The Olympic flame was lit in Greece and handed over to France in June. In total, around 11,000 people will take part in the relay. Among them are footballer Didier Drogba, basketball player Tony Park, survivors of Nazi concentration camps, victims of the terrorist attack in Nice, astronauts and orderlies.
The Paris Olympics begin on July 27 and will run until August 11. In total, more than 15,000 athletes from 206 countries have registered.
